Adult Mental Health First Aid
Similar to medical First Aid training, Mental Health First Aid (MHFA) teaches individuals how to help those experiencing mental health challenges or crises.

WHO:  This course is appropriate for adults 16 and older who want to learn how to help a person experiencing a mental health challenge. The training is ideal for first responders; clergy and congregations; professors; healthcare workers and non-professionals in the community.

WHY: Mental health challenges such as depression, anxiety, psychosis and substance use are shockingly common in the United States.  In any given year, more than one in five American adults will have a mental health problem.  The National Council for Behavioral Health certifies individuals throughout the nation to provide Mental Health First Aid courses to prepare communities with the knowledge and skills to help individuals who are developing a mental health problem or experiencing a mental health crisis.  Identified on SAMHSA's National Registry of Evidence-Based Programs and Practices, the training helps the public better identify, understand and respond to signs of mental illnesses.  For more information, visit www.mentalhealthfirstaid.org.
